Biography
Jesse Metcalfe was born on April 2, 1981, in San Antonio, Texas. He is an American actor best known for his work in television and film. Before becoming an actor, Metcalfe aspired to become a veterinarian, which shows his diverse interests and talents. Below is a detailed look at his personal information:

Early Career
Jesse Metcalfe's early career started with small roles in television and theater. He honed his craft by participating in local plays and community theater productions. This experience helped him develop his acting skills and prepared him for larger roles.
In 2002, Metcalfe made his television debut in the soap opera "Passions," where he played the role of Ethan Winthrop. His portrayal of the character earned him widespread recognition and a dedicated fanbase. The role not only launched his career but also showcased his ability to bring depth to complex characters.
